All Products
 
                
      Don't just take our word for it,
here is what others have to say...
    
  
    
    
 
    
   
  Easily search and select your own products
    
   Karma Holiday Tea Towel Bee     
    
    
      
      
    
    $13.50           
   
       
   
  
     
    
   Karma Holiday Tea Towel Deer     
    
    
      
      
    
    $13.50           
   
       
   
  
      
         
                 
                 
                 
                 
                 
                 
                 
                 
                 
                 
           
                 
                 
                 
                 
                 
                 
                 
                 
                 
                 
                